just booked a track day at the farm which as many would know is a private racetrack owned by the ex CEO of coca cola. i just viewed some photos of the track on the RATS website and it looks sweet!!!! Apparently its around 5.5km long with 22 or 23 turns with blind corners, elevation and camber changes that test every part of the bike and rider. Times for the average riders are around the 3 minute plus mark with the likes of james spence and kevin magee pulling 2.40's!!!!! considering eastern creek is around 1.35's for racers and 2.00 for the average rider, it must be one hell of a lap. now i just have to find the damn place.........
